// TAILCTL_DEFAULT_BUFFER: line buffer for the Snipegrass log-tailing CLI.
// Raised from 512 to 2048 after the Folkvane release dropped lines under
// burst load. Do not lower without re-running the soak test on staging.
// Validated in the build referenced by the token directly below this comment.

pipeline stamp: htk31_f769b577b3028a4e9958e5bb8d1259a

### Action Item: Spoolhaven Retry Storm

From last Tuesday's outage: the Spoolhaven print service retried failed jobs without backoff, saturating the render pool. Fix merged; retries now use capped exponential backoff with jitter. Owner will monitor for a week before closing. The agreed retry constants are recorded below.

constants for yadup-kajof:
RATE_LIMITS = {
    "zorwyn": 1,
    "druwyn": 1,
}

Handover note — Marit to Olen, re: Thornquist hardware lab access. Contractors from Pellvane Systems will be on site through Friday fitting the new bench power rails. Please ensure they sign the visitor log each morning and wear safety glasses past the yellow line — no exceptions, the lab supervisor is strict on this. Equipment racks 4–6 must stay powered; everything else can be isolated. They'll need the lab door code to come and go unescorted, which is as follows.

door code, yagap-bahof: bdg-O-05

## Runbook: Gaugepile Sidecar — Release Checklist

Heads up: the sidecar ships with every app pod, so a bad config fans out fast. Before cutting a release, confirm the flush interval hasn't drifted from what the Tallyhouse aggregator expects, or you'll see sawtooth gaps in dashboards. Rollbacks are cheap — just repin the image tag. Canary one node pool first, watch for ten minutes, then proceed. The values to verify against are these.

config for bagep-yafof:
quenath:
  pin: 8584
  metrics_host: metrics.quenath.tolvaqsys.internal
  tenant: pelath
  seal: seal_ed102645